Output dd3a20b2227b6ccc53690b63b276586b20da9ef084bf5677f956c3d06757a9dd:4

value
19223576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ec5998729443cd4de28df318c8c3490ab35179 OP_EQUAL
address
31sBjcvoKnqMLmT7Z8vWv5KnrF2kyp72yD
transaction
dd3a20b2227b6ccc53690b63b276586b20da9ef084bf5677f956c3d06757a9dd
spent
true